Wcp知识管理系统部署文档
Wcp知识管理系统部署文档
环境
CentOS-6.5-x86_64-bin-DVD1.iso
jdk-7u79-linux-x64.tar.gz
apache-tomcat-7.0.72.tar.gz
MySQL-5.6.33-1.el6.x86_64.rpm-bundle.tar
WCP知识管理系统v3.2.0(免费版.开源) http://www.wcpdoc.com/webdoc/view/Pub8a2831b350e6b01f0150e6c1ad5a009f.html
下载地址:百度云盘http://yun.baidu.com/s/1gfoHuYB
配置IP地址
vi /etc/sysconfig/network-scripts/ifcfg-eth0 #摁i键开始编辑
… …
BOOTPROTO=none #不指定(dhcp|static)
IPADDR=192.168.8.11 #配置IP地址
NETMASK=255.255.255.0 #配置子网掩码
GATEWAY=192.168.8.1 #配置网关
:wq #(先摁esc键)保存并退出编辑
service network restart #重启网卡
ifconfig #查看是否生效
DNS:
Vim /etc/resolv.conf
添加:
配置JAVA
解压jdkxxxxxxx
拷贝jdk到/opt/java/目录下
chmod 777 /opt/java/bin/* #设置bin目录有执行权限
配置环境变量:
Vim /etc/profile
在文件末尾加上如下:
JAVA_HOME=/opt/java (注意路径和上面拷贝位置要一致)
PATH=$PATH:$JAVA_HOME/bin
export JAVA_HOME
export PATH
:wq #(先摁esc键)保存并退出编辑
重新加载profile文件
#source /etc/profile
java -version #如果成功,则能查看到java版本号
****************************************************************
如果显示的是旧版本则如下操作:
1. # cd /usr/bin
2. # ln -s -f /usr/java/jre/bin/java
3. # ln -s -f /usr/java/bin/javac
# java -version
则可以看到jdk版本已经正常
************************************************************************
配置tomcat
解压缩apache-tomcat-7.0.72.tar.gz
#tar -ixvf apache-tomcat-7.0.72.tar.gz
拷贝apache-tomcat-7.0.72到/opt/目录下。
重命令为 tomcat7
#mv apache-tomcat-7.0.72 tomcat7
配置mysql
rpm -qa|grep mariadb #查看是否有冲突包
rpm -e --nodeps xxxxxxx #卸载冲突包,xxx代表查到到的文件
rpm -qa|grep -i mysql #查看是否有冲突包
rpm -e --nodeps xxxxxxxxxx #卸载冲突包,xxx代表查到到的文件
安装mysql的服务器和客户端
解压缩:MySQL-5.6.33-1.el6.x86_64.rpm-bundle.tar
#tar -ixvf MySQL-5.6.33-1.el6.x86_64.rpm-bundle.tar
解压后得到如下rpm包:
安装客户端和服务器端
rpm -ivh MySQL-client-5.6.33-1.el6.x86_64.rpm
rpm -ivh MySQL-server-5.6.33-1.el6.x86_64.rpm
启动服务
#service mysqldstart
netstat -nat | grep 3306 #如果有3306端口,说明mysql启动成功
修改mysql的root用户初始密码
cat /root/.mysql_secret #查看mysql密码
mysql -uroot -pxJ9Jo4kLbc9uM0rq #进入mysql,"xJ9Jo4kLbc9uM0rq"为mysql密码 (注意-u和-p 后面没有空格)
#SET PASSWORD FOR 'root'@'localhost' = PASSWORD('123456') (把root密码设置成123456)
flush privileges; #刷新权限
quit #退出mysql
修改mysql配置文件,设置不区分大小写:
1、先复制模板到/etc目录下
#cp /usr/share/doc/MySQL-server-5.6.33/my-default.cnf /etc/my.cnf
2、设置 不区分大小写
#vim /etc/my.con
在[mysqld]节点下,加入一行:lower_case_table_names=1
3、重启MySQL即可;
配置防火墙iptables
如果启用防火墙,需要添加规则:
vi /etc/sysconfig/iptables #添加防火墙规则,用于外网访问
#摁i键开始编辑 ,
-A INPUT -m state -state NEW -m tcp -p tcp -dport 8080 -j ACCEPT
(端口号8080,是tomcat的默认端口)
:wq #(先摁esc键)保存并退出编辑
service iptables restart #重启防火墙/etc/init.d/iptables restart
----------------------------------------------
vi /etc/sysconfig/iptables #添加防火墙规则,用于外网访问。 #摁i键开始编辑
-A INPUT -m state -state NEW -m tcp -p tcp -dport 3306 -j ACCEPT
(3306是mysql端口号)
:wq #(先摁esc键)保存并退出编辑
service iptables restart #重启防火墙/etc/init.d/iptables restart
部署wpc知识库
下载得到linux系统文件如下:
1、 数据库脚本:wcp2.v3.2.1.none.opensource.sql
2、 程序文件
3、 复制 上图程序文件夹到 tomcat下的webapps目录中
4、 登录mysql数据库(数据库名称随意,但要与后面说的jdbc.properties内容一致,这里名称为:wcp2)
创建数据库:
查看数据库:
选择数据路:
执行wcp2.v3.2.1.none.opensource.sql脚本
(目录是脚本的存放位置)
退出数据库。
5、 修改wcp系统程序文件的配置文件
目录下的jdbc.properties文件
修改相应信息:
6、 修改目录下config.properties文件
7、重启 tomcat服务
访问登录测试
http://192.168.1.150:8080/wcp/login/webPage.html; (ip为服务器ip)
用户名:sysadmin
密码:111111
登录后:
WCP产品部署手册V3.2.1.docx下载:
http://www.wcpdoc.com/webdoc/view/Pub8a2831b3572e7bc501573b5900270006.html